Understanding Burnout:

Burnout is more than just a fleeting sense of fatigue; it's a chronic state of emotional exhaustion caused by prolonged stress, often stemming from work or personal obligations. It's characterized by a sense of detachment, reduced effectiveness, and a prevailing feeling of cynicism. Recognizing the signs of burnout is essential for addressing it effectively.

Signs of Burnout:

1. Physical and Emotional Exhaustion: Feeling drained, tired, and emotionally spent, even after a good night's sleep.

2. Lack of Interest: Losing interest in activities that once brought joy and enthusiasm.

3. Reduced Performance: A decline in productivity, creativity, and overall effectiveness.

4. Cynical Outlook: Developing a negative or cynical attitude towards work, life, or people around you.

5. Isolation: Withdrawing from social interactions and feeling disconnected from colleagues, friends, and family.

Alleviating Burnout:

1. Prioritize Self-Care: Make self-care non-negotiable. Engage in activities that replenish your energy—whether it's reading, taking walks, practicing mindfulness, or spending quality time with loved ones.

2. Set Boundaries: Learn to say no when your plate is full. Setting clear boundaries helps prevent overload and gives you the space to breathe.

3. Break Tasks into Manageable Steps: Overwhelming tasks can exacerbate burnout. Break them down into smaller, achievable steps to prevent feeling swamped.

4. Celebrate Achievements: Acknowledge your accomplishments, no matter how small. Celebrating milestones boosts self-esteem and motivation.

5. Find Purpose: Reconnect with your passions and align your daily tasks with your long-term goals. A sense of purpose provides the intrinsic motivation needed to combat burnout.

6. Seek Support: Don't hesitate to talk to friends, family, or a professional if you're feeling overwhelmed. Sometimes, sharing your feelings can provide valuable insights and alleviate the burden.

7. Change the Routine: Inject novelty into your routine. Trying new things stimulates your mind and can reignite your enthusiasm for life.

8. Practice Mindfulness: Engage in mindfulness practices like meditation and deep breathing to stay present and reduce stress.
